Key Responsibilities
- Demonstrating a solid understanding of NDIS principles, legislation, systems, and processes to ensure compliance and best practice in the support provided
- Demonstrated skills and understanding of planning, implementing, and evaluating plans
- Monitoring and managing the participants budget and coordination of plan
- Building knowledge of local services and organisations participants can utilise
- Engaging and coordinating service providers on behalf of the participants and linking participants to relevant providers
- Meet with and engage participants to implement their plans
- Engage participants informal support (family, carers etc.)
- Working with participants to help build their own capacity and independence, while ensuring choice and control
- Engage with NDIA staff and LAC's
- Assessing and managing risk in line with Soul Services WA's policies and procedures
- Achievement of key performance indicators
- Managing participant expectations, feedback and complaints
- Provide the NDIA with reports on outcomes and success indicators within the agreed reporting frequency
- Knowledge and understanding of NDIS Quality and Safeguarding and reporting
